      Issue Summary

      The View in portal link is broken in service projects after a Data Center/Server-to-Cloud migration. For affected customer instances, the link does not open the request form in the portal.

      Steps to Reproduce

      1. Navigate to Project settings > Request types.
      2. For any request type, click More actions (three dots) > View in portal.
      1. The link opens a page that shows an error stating that the page doesn't exist.
      1. Go back to Request types, click More actions (three dots) > Edit, and then click View in portal from the edit screen.
      1. This time, the correct request form page opens in the portal.

       

      It appears that the Request types > View in portal link is using the serviceDeskId when it should be using the portalId.

      Expected Results

      Clicking More actions (three dots) > View in portal from the Request types page opens the correct request form in the customer portal.

      Actual Results

      The View in portal link from the Request types page is incorrect, and the request form does not open in the customer portal. Instead, an error page is displayed indicating that the page does not exist.

      Workaround

      Open the request form via:
      More actions (three dots) > Edit > View in portal from the request type edit screen.
